| Obverse description | Central device depicts a detailed relief view of the Gothic church of Lissewege, Belgium, with characteristic tall nave, lancet windows, and flanking ruins in the foreground. The place name LISSEWEGE appears prominently in the lower field, with the circulation date legend IN OMLOOP VANAF 6-6-84 inscribed in the exergue. |

| Reverse description | Central field features a stylized four-lobed cloverleaf or quatrefoil ornamental device in high relief, surrounded by concentric circular bands. The denomination 100 appears above and the date 1984 below within the central lobe, with the issuer name ABDYEN across the middle of the device. |
